I live in a south Asian country.Bangladesh,to be exact.But I put in USA as my country in my 3ds and I also joined Club Nintendo and Nintendo Newsletter.Won't I still be able to get the code?

Dunno what else to say here. As long as you have registered, you will get an email giving you your demo code.

Hope I helped!

